The Winfield-Mt. Union football team dropped their district contest with Lynnville-Sully Friday night by a 44-6 score.

The Hawk defense made things difficult on the Wolves all night, limiting WMU to just 65 yards of total offense on the night while finding the end zone seven times in the win. Winfield-Mt. Union was led by Austin Lee through the air, he was five for eight for 43 yards. Broc Mullin was the leading ground gainer for WMU with eight carries for 17 yards. Mullins scored the Wolves only points of the night, returning an interception 47 yards for a touchdown. With the loss WMU is now 1-4 on the year and will host Montezuma next Friday.
